Originally posted by KingGilgamesh View PostFlat fees are junk for the most part. Pretty much the same reason Wilder turned down his too. I thought this was something everyone learned back in the Pacman Mayweather days.
It was a guarantee. In addition, to the monies he would have made off the back end through the percentages of all revenue ******s: Such as the live gate, closed circuit, online ******ing and all pay per views sold on television.
If he would have done Mayweather numbers he could have more than tripled the amount of the $25 Mil guarantee per fight he was being offered by the PBC.
They will eventually iron out a deal soon though. They are very close. Canelo just wants a fight by fight based contract without any long term exclusive deals. He wants to remain free.
